Updates i18next from 26.2.0 to 26.3.6

Release notes

Sourced from i18next's releases.

v26.3.6

  • fix: allow TypeScript 7 in the optional typescript peer dependency range (^5 || ^6 || ^7). With typescript@7.0.2 in a project, npm install failed with an ERESOLVE peer conflict. The published types are TS7-compatible as-is: every test/typescript suite produces identical results under 6.0 and 7.0.2. Reported in react-i18next#1927, thanks @​andikapradanaarif.

v26.3.5

  • fix: $t() nesting options blocks that span multiple lines are now parsed. nest() decided where the nested key ends by testing match[1] with /{.*}/, whose dot does not cross line breaks — so a $t(key, { ... }) options object containing a newline was treated as having no options, mis-split as formatters, and the nested lookup ran without its options (placeholders stayed unresolved). The nesting regexp itself already matches newlines inside $t(...); adding the s (dotAll) flag makes multiline options behave like the single-line form. Thanks @​spokodev (#2440).
  • fix: getUsedParamsDetails (the returnDetails: true path) no longer mutates the passed replace object. It wrote count straight onto options.replace so the returned usedParams would include it — a caller reusing one replace object across t() calls then carried a stale count into later interpolations (e.g. a previous call's count: 5 rendered instead of the current call's value). The details are now built from a copy; usedParams still includes count. Thanks @​spokodev (#2441).
  • fix: with the default skipOnVariables: true + escapeValue: true, a {{placeholder}} carried inside an interpolated value now stays literal even when the value contains escapable characters. The skip logic advanced the regex lastIndex by the raw value length, but the escaped text written into the string is longer, so lastIndex landed inside the inserted value and a trailing {{placeholder}} in it got interpolated — leaking another in-scope variable that should have stayed literal (values without escapable characters were already skipped correctly). The advance now uses the escaped length that is actually written, and the regex-safe $-doubling is applied only at the String.replace call so it can't distort the length arithmetic. Thanks @​spokodev (#2442).

v26.3.4

  • fix(security): deepExtend (used by addResourceBundle(..., deep, overwrite)) no longer recurses into inherited properties. It checked key existence with the in operator, which walks the prototype chain, so a source key matching an inherited built-in (e.g. hasOwnProperty, toString) caused recursion into the shared Object.prototype function and, with overwrite: true, could overwrite e.g. Object.prototype.hasOwnProperty.call with a non-callable value — corrupting a shared built-in process-wide (DoS). Existence is now checked with Object.prototype.hasOwnProperty.call, so such keys are copied as plain own data instead. This complements the existing __proto__/constructor guard and is also strictly more correct for an own-property merge. Only affects applications that pass attacker-controlled data with deep: true and overwrite: true; no standard backend/integration does this. Distinct from CVE-2026-48713 / CVE-2026-48714 (different packages, setPath mechanism). Thanks to zx (Jace) for the responsible disclosure.

v26.3.3

  • fix(types): selector t($ => $.arr, { returnObjects: true, context }) on a JSON array of heterogeneous objects now preserves each element's full shape (e.g. { transKey1: string; transKey2: string }[]) instead of collapsing to a union of partial element types. Two type-level causes: (1) FilterKeys evaluated the whole array element type at once, so keyof (A | B) only saw the keys common to every element — it now distributes over the object union and filters each element independently; (2) when TypeScript merges mismatched array element types it injects phantom optional undefined keys (e.g. transKey1_withContext?: undefined on elements that don't define it), which the context-detection helpers mistook for real context variants — they now skip keys typed as undefined. Also adds a dedicated context + returnObjects: true selector overload using const Fn + ReturnType<Fn>, so Target is no longer collapsed to unknown via ApplyTarget. Resolves Problem 1 of #2398 (Problem 2 was already fixed on master). Thanks @​sauravgupta-dotcom (#2438). Fixes #2398.

v26.3.2

  • fix: chained formatters with a parenthesised option that contains the format separator (e.g. join(separator: ', ')) now work at any position in the chain, not just first. Previously the comma-in-parens reassembly only repaired formats[0], so {{v, uppercase, join(separator: ', ')}} split the join(...) option on the inner comma and never rejoined it, producing corrupt output. Replaced the first-position-only repair with a position-independent pass that re-joins fragments until each open paren closes. Thanks @​spokodev (#2437).

v26.3.1

  • fix(types): t() with a keyPrefix no longer pollutes its return type with sibling keys' values. A regression in 26.3.0 — the [Res] extends [never] guards added to KeysBuilderWithReturnObjects / KeysBuilderWithoutReturnObjects turned the builders into deferred conditional types, so KeyPrefix<Ns> stopped resolving to a literal union and keyPrefix inference widened to the whole namespace. Symptom: useTranslation(ns, { keyPrefix: 'a.b' }) then t('title') would resolve to '<a.b>.title' | '<other.path>.title' | ... instead of just the scoped value. Affected every react-i18next user using keyPrefix. Restored to the eager 26.2.0 form. The same-namespace conflict handling from #2434 still works via _DropConflictKeys at the merge layer (in options.d.ts). Thanks @​aaronrosenthal (#2436).

v26.3.0

  • feat(types): introduce ResourceNamespaceMap — a separate mergeable augmentation surface for namespace resource types, designed for monorepos where multiple packages each want to contribute their own namespaces. Previously, every package had to coordinate on a single CustomTypeOptions.resources declaration (or fall back to typing dependency namespaces as any) because resources is a single property of an interface and TypeScript reports TS2717 when two declarations of the same property disagree. The new interface merges naturally across declare module 'i18next' blocks, so each package can ship its own i18next.d.ts independently. Per-property merge handles same-namespace contributions from multiple packages, and same-key/different-literal conflicts are silently dropped to avoid poisoning t() overload resolution. Fully backwards-compatible — existing CustomTypeOptions.resources augmentations continue to work, and both surfaces can coexist. Scalar options (defaultNS, returnNull, enableSelector, etc.) still belong on CustomTypeOptions. Thanks @​sh3xu (#2434). Fixes #2409.

Updates react-draggable from 4.5.0 to 4.7.0

Changelog

Sourced from react-draggable's changelog.

4.7.0 (Jun 18, 2026)

  • Feature: add a nonce prop to support a strict Content Security Policy. It's applied to the dynamically-injected user-select <style> element so a style-src policy without 'unsafe-inline' no longer blocks it. When omitted, webpack's __webpack_nonce__ global is used if available. enableUserSelectHack={false} remains a no-prop opt-out. (#808, closes #791)
  • Internal: de-duplicate redundant tsc compilation in the build/CI pipeline.

4.6.0 (May 29, 2026)

  • Internal: Migrate library source from Flow to TypeScript. Types are now generated from source instead of hand-maintained, eliminating Flow/TypeScript drift. The build uses tsup (CommonJS + ESM + generated declarations) with webpack for the UMD bundle. No public API change — the CommonJS export shape (module.exports === Draggable, plus .default and .DraggableCore), the UMD ReactDraggable global, and the shipped type surface are all unchanged. (#805)
  • Feature: ship an ESM build and an exports map alongside the existing CommonJS entry, so the package can be imported natively in both module systems. (#805)
  • Fix: treat ctrl+click as a right-click on macOS so it no longer starts a drag. (#786)
  • Fix: remove a global module declaration from the TypeScript types to prevent type pollution. (#787)
  • Internal: Support React 19 (dependency upgrade and nodeRef-based browser tests).
  • Internal: Migrate the test suite from Karma/Jasmine to Vitest, expand unit coverage, and run CI across Node 20, 22, and 24. (#785, #788)
  • Docs: Modernize the README and publish a GitHub Pages demo site. (#790)

Updates react-i18next from 17.0.8 to 17.0.10

Changelog

Sourced from react-i18next's changelog.

17.0.10

  • fix(warnings): the useTranslation and Trans "You will need to pass in an i18next instance" warnings now match the useSSR wording, mentioning the props/context alternatives and the most common unexplained cause at scale: duplicate react-i18next copies in monorepo setups. The Trans variant also referenced the internal i18nextReactModule name; it now points to the public initReactI18next API.
  • feat(warnings): development-only warning (SUSPENDED_WHILE_LOADING, logged once) right before useTranslation suspends while translations are loading. With the default useSuspense: true and no <Suspense> boundary this previously surfaced as a blank screen or a cryptic React error; the warning now names both fixes (add a <Suspense> boundary or set react.useSuspense: false). No-op in production builds; the process.env.NODE_ENV check is wrapped so runtimes without a process global (raw ESM in the browser, some edge runtimes) stay silent instead of throwing.
  • ci: weekly workflow typechecking the test suite against @types/react@next / @types/react-dom@next, so the next React major's type changes (like the React 18 TFunctionResult/children wave) surface before user reports.

17.0.9

  • fix: allow TypeScript 7 in the optional typescript peer dependency range (^5 || ^6 || ^7). With typescript@7.0.2 in a project, npm install failed with an ERESOLVE peer conflict. Fixes #1927, thanks @​andikapradanaarif.
  • fix(types): <Trans t={t} ns="ns" …> with a t from useTranslation(['ns']) now typechecks under TypeScript 7. TS7 intersects the Ns inference candidates coming from the t prop (readonly ['ns']) and the ns prop ('ns') into an unsatisfiable 'ns' & readonly ['ns'], where TS6 resolved them. The ns prop on TransProps, TransSelectorProps and IcuTransWithoutContextProps now also accepts a single namespace out of an array-typed Ns (Ns | (Ns extends readonly (infer S extends string)[] ? S : never)) — which matches runtime behavior and is unchanged under TS5/TS6.
